How much it'll cost Everton to sign Guela Doue and Liam Delap as David Moyes decides on transfer
Everton are showing interest in signing Chelsea striker Liam Delap and Strasbourg right-back Guela Doue.
Delap, 23, joined Chelsea from Ipswich for £30million last June, but has since struggled to impress, scoring three goals in 47 appearances across all competitions for the London club.
Doue, also 23, has been on the books at Strasbourg since July 2024 and last term, he played 34 times in total - scoring twice and supplying seven assists - to help his side reach the semi-finals of the Coupe de France and Conference League, as well as finish eighth in Ligue 1.
Everton are now keen on deals for both of the players with David Moyes eager to strengthen his squad ahead of the Premier League season kicking off against Crystal Palace at 3pm on Saturday.

What Everton need to know about the finances of Liam Delap and Guela Doue double deal
Ultimately, both players are in demand and that's going to bump up the figures that The Friedkin Group will need to spend in order to snap them up.
According to talkSPORT on Thursday, Nottingham Forest are currently in pole position to sign Delap ahead of Everton and Leeds United.
Chelsea want £50m for the former Manchester City man.
As for Doue, Sky Sports report that Moyes' preferred right-back option this summer is Ivory Coast international Doue, while Arsenal's Ben White and Crystal Palace's Daniel Munoz are also on the Everton list.
It would, however, cost £40m to pry Doue away from Strasbourg, meaning that the pair would join the Blues as two of their most expensive signings of all time should the demands be met.
Where Delap and Doue would rank in Everton's most expensive signings
Everton's current record signing stands at £50m for the signing of Richarlison from Watford way back in 2018.
If Chelsea's price tag is met by Everton, it would mean that Delap would become their joint-record arrival.
If £40m is paid for Doue, he'd be the new joint-third most expensive signing in the Merseyside club's history alongside Tyler Dibling.
He'd also become the all-time most expensive defender the Toffees have ever had.
